An Educational Reminder: Why It’s Time for Florida’s OMMU to Say “Cannabis”

When you navigate the medical system in our state, you will quickly become familiar with the Florida Office of Medical Ma*****na Use (OMMU). The OMMU acts as the ultimate authority for our state's program. They handle the Florida Medical Ma*****na Use Registry, issue patient ID cards, and enforce strict safety standards. We deeply respect their role in keeping patients safe....
